THE ROLE:

We are seeking an experienced SoC DFX Engineer to help define, design, and verify robust Design for Test (DFT) and Design for Debug (DFD) solutions for complex, high‑performance SoCs. In this role, you will collaborate closely with architecture, RTL, firmware, and verification teams to integrate DFX features that enable efficient silicon validation, bring‑up, and debug across the full product lifecycle. This position offers hands‑on technical depth, system‑level problem solving, and the opportunity to influence DFX strategy in advanced processor designs.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Collaborate with architects, hardware engineers, and firmware engineers to understand the new DFX features to be designed and verified.
  • Work on designing and integrating DFX logic in complex SoCs.
  • Build test plan documentation, accounting for interactions with other features, the hardware, the firmware, and the software driver use cases
  • Estimate the time required to write the new feature tests and any required changes to the test environment
  • Build the directed and random verification tests
  • Debug test failures to determine the root cause; work with RTL and firmware engineers to resolve design defects and correct any test issues
  • Review functional and code coverage metrics – modify or add tests or constrain random tests to meet the coverage requirements

PREFERRED EXPERIENCE:

  • Experience with DFT (Design for Test) and DFD (Design for Debug) architecture, design, and verification
  • Experience with JTAG, LBIST, MBIST, Scan, and ATPG
  • Familiarity with the Tessent tools suite, including Scan and ATPG
  • Familiarity with test pattern generation, bring‑up, and debug on ATE
  • Experience with post‑silicon bring‑up
  • Experience with IP‑level and ASIC verification
  • Experience debugging firmware and RTL code using simulation tools
  • Experience with Verilog, SystemVerilog, SystemC, and C++
  • Experience automating workflows in a distributed compute environment
  • Experience with UVM concepts and the SystemVerilog language
  • Experience with static timing analysis and constraints
  • Familiarity with ICL/PDL
  • Scripting language experience: Perl, Ruby, Makefile, and shell preferred
  • Exposure to leadership or mentorship is an asset

ACADEMIC CREDENTIALS:

  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, or a related field.
